Analysis of Popular Nail Course Types: Gel Nails and Japanese Nail Art
Professional Gel Nail Course
Gel nails are currently the most mainstream nail service in the market. A professional gel nail course will teach you how to properly prepare the nail surface, apply base gel, color gel, and top coat, as well as how to safely remove gel nails. You will also learn various extension techniques, such as hard gel extensions and polygel extensions, to meet the needs of different customers.
Japanese Nail Art Course
Japanese nail art is famous for its exquisite hand-painted patterns, delicate color blending, and high-quality products. A Japanese nail art course will focus on cultivating your painting skills, teaching you how to use fine brushes to draw complex patterns such as flowers, lace, and marble textures. You will also learn how to use Japanese-style nail accessories to create elegant and unique nail designs.
When choosing a course, it is important to consider your career goals. If you want to quickly enter the industry and provide basic nail services, a gel nail course is a good starting point. If you aspire to become a high-end nail artist and create unique nail art designs, a Japanese nail art course will be indispensable. Many comprehensive nail diploma courses cover both areas, providing you with a well-rounded education.
Career Prospects and Development Paths for Nail Technicians
After completing a professional nail course in Hong Kong, your career path will be full of infinite possibilities. Junior nail technicians usually choose to accumulate experience in large chain beauty salons or professional nail shops. As their skills mature and their customer base stabilizes, many nail technicians choose to be promoted to senior nail technicians, store managers, or even open their own nail studios.
In Hong Kong, the income of an experienced and skilled nail technician is very considerable. Especially those nail technicians who have mastered advanced Japanese painting techniques or unique extension skills can often attract a group of loyal high-end customers. In addition, the working hours in the nail industry are relatively flexible, which is very suitable for modern women pursuing a work-life balance.

Which nail course is suitable for beginners?
Beginners are advised to start with a basic gel nail course or a comprehensive nail certificate course. These courses will teach from the most basic nail structure and tool usage, gradually transitioning to complex painting and extension techniques.
How long does it take to learn nail art?
Learning time varies by course. Basic courses usually take a few weeks to a month or two, while comprehensive professional diploma courses may require three to six months of continuous learning and practice.
